Team Rubicon is a nonprofit organization composed of military veterans and civilian volunteers that provides disaster relief, response, and recovery services worldwide. Founded in 2010, the organization leverages the skills and discipline of veterans to assist communities affected by natural and man-made disasters.
Key Features
- Mobilizes military veterans and volunteers for disaster response
- Specializes in rapid deployment to affected areas
- Focuses on emergency response, recovery, and resilience-building
- Operates globally, responding to natural disasters such as hurricanes, earthquakes, floods, and more
- Provides training and leadership development for volunteers
